Canada - 15-29 Year-Olds Youth Not in Employment, Education or Training

Since 2014, Canada 15-29 Year-Olds Youth Not in Employment, Education or Training decreased by 3.4points year on year. In 2019, the country was number 23 among other countries in 15-29 Year-Olds Youth Not in Employment, Education or Training with 11.27 Percent of Relevant Age Group. Canada is overtaken by Lithuania, which was number 22 at 11.31 Percent of Relevant Age Group and is followed by Ireland at 11.05 Percent of Relevant Age Group. Turkey ranked the highest with 28.77 Percent of Relevant Age Group in 2019, that is +8.6points compared to 2018. Brazil, Italy and Colombia resp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Brazil witnessed the best average annual growth at +4.9points per year, while Ireland recorded the worst performance at -9.3points per year.
